Let p denote the population proportion of the University of lowa students who support the creation of a wealth tax in the U.S.. We want to test Ho: p=0.5 versus HA: p>0.5 Suppose we surveyed a random sample of 200 University of lowa students and got a test statistic value of 1.15. Which of the following R commands give us the correct p value? Please select all that apply. Hint: this question has two correct answers. 1-pt(1.15, df = 199) pt(1.15, df = 199) 1-pt(-1.15, df = 199) pt(-1.15, df = 199)
